Blood Drive Slated for March 29 at Bone and Joint Institute

Bone and Joint Institute of Tennessee (BJIT) and Williamson Medical Center (WMC) are hosting a drive with Blood Assurance, the sole provider of blood products for WMC, on March 29, 2022, from 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. Donors are encouraged to sign up via the Blood Assurance website, though walk-ins are welcome. 

“The need to replenish our shelves is significant,” said Max Winitz, public relations specialist with Blood Assurance, in a statement. “In order for us to provide an adequate blood supply to those fighting traumatic injuries or debilitating illnesses at Williamson Medical Center, it’s vital for the community to roll up a sleeve and donate. We are excited to once again be partnering with the hospital and BJIT for another lifesaving blood drive.”

The Blood Assurance mobile unit will collect the donations in the parking lot of BJIT, according to the announcement.

The partnership between WMC, BJIT and Blood Assurance plans to host 13 blood drives through 2022, according to the announcement.

Donors must be at least 17 years old—or 16 years old with parental consent—weigh 110 pounds or more, and be in good health, according to the announcement. Donors are asked to drink plenty of fluids—avoiding caffeine—and eat a meal that is rich in iron prior to donating, according to the announcement.
